WebJan 21, 2016 · Commercially Useful Function (CUF) An MWSBE performs a commercially useful function when it is responsible for a discrete task or group of tasks required in the contract using its own forces or by actively supervising on-site the execution of tasks. An MWSBE has to be certified in the NAICS code in which they are performing.
